Os Ingredientes Farmacêuticos Ativos (APIs) são as substâncias nos medicamentos responsáveis por seus efeitos terapêuticos. Nesta seção, você encontrará uma ampla variedade de APIs destinados a uso em pesquisa. Esses compostos são essenciais para o desenvolvimento, teste e validação de novas formulações farmacêuticas.
